U code network High severity

U002A High Speed CAN Communication Bus A - Signal Invalid

The OBD2 code U002A indicates a problem with the High-Speed CAN communication bus A, specifically that the signal being received is invalid or not within expected parameters

Definition

The OBD2 code U002A indicates a problem with the High-Speed CAN communication bus A, specifically that the signal being received is invalid or not within expected parameters

Common causes

  • Faulty CAN bus wiring or connectors
  • Short circuit in the CAN bus
  • Open circuit in the CAN bus
  • Faulty CAN bus module or ECU
  • Interference from other electrical components
  • Corroded or damaged terminals
  • Incorrect termination resistors
  • Software or firmware issues in the ECU
  • Grounding issues in the vehicle's electrical system
  • Faulty or incompatible aftermarket accessories

Common misdiagnoses

  • Faulty CAN bus wiring
  • Defective ECU (Electronic Control Unit)
  • Bad ground connections
  • Faulty sensors or modules on the CAN bus
  • Corrupted software or firmware in the ECU
  • Intermittent electrical connections
  • Battery or power supply issues
  • Incorrectly installed aftermarket accessories
  • Faulty diagnostic tools or equipment
  • Other communication bus issues (e.g., LIN bus problems)

Troubleshooting steps

  1. 1. Check for Additional Codes

    Use an OBD-II scanner to check for any other related trouble codes. Sometimes, multiple codes can provide more context about the issue

  2. 2. Inspect Wiring and Connectors

    Visual Inspection: Check the wiring harness and connectors associated with the High-Speed CAN Bus for any signs of damage, corrosion, or loose connections

  3. 3. Connector Pins

    Ensure that the pins in the connectors are not bent, corroded, or pushed back

  4. 4. Test the CAN Bus

    Multimeter Test: Use a multimeter to check the voltage levels on the CAN High and CAN Low wires. The typical voltage levels should be around 2.5V when the bus is idle

  5. 5. Scope Test

    If available, use an oscilloscope to observe the CAN signals. You should see a square wave pattern if the bus is functioning correctly

  6. 6. Check for Short Circuits

    Inspect the CAN bus wiring for any shorts to ground or to other wires. A short can cause signal invalid errors

  7. 7. Inspect Modules on the CAN Bus

    Identify all modules connected to the High-Speed CAN Bus A. Check for any malfunctioning modules that may be causing communication issues

  8. 8. Disconnect each module one at a time to see if the code clears, indicating which module may be causing the problem

  9. 9. Check for Interference

    Ensure that there are no aftermarket devices or modifications that could be interfering with the CAN Bus communication

  10. 10. Battery and Ground Connections

    Check the vehicle’s battery voltage and ensure that all ground connections are clean and secure. Poor ground connections can lead to communication issues

  11. 11. Update or Reprogram Modules

    In some cases, a software update or reprogramming of the affected modules may be necessary. Check with the manufacturer for any available updates

  12. 12. Clear Codes and Test Drive

    After performing the above checks and repairs, clear the trouble codes and take the vehicle for a test drive to see if the code returns

  13. 13. Consult Technical Service Bulletins (TSBs)

    Look for any TSBs related to the specific make and model of the vehicle. Manufacturers may have known issues and solutions for this code.1

  14. 14. Professional Diagnosis

    If the issue persists after all troubleshooting steps, consider seeking help from a professional mechanic or dealership with experience in diagnosing CAN Bus issues. By following these steps, you should be able to identify and resolve the issue related to the U002A code. Always refer to the vehicle's service manual for specific details related to the make and model you are working on